Darrell’s Barrhaven Story:

Darrell grew up in downtown Ottawa and moved to Barrhaven in 1989. He says that he and his wife moved here for the house, but have stayed because of the community. Barrhaven in 1989 was a different place than it is now. With very few stores and businesses, driving out to see the house made him wonder why anyone would want to live here. Over the years, the community has grown as well as the amenities and Darrell jokes that he has been here since before Barrhaven even had a McDonald’s (we now have 3!) 

From the early days, Darrell loved the community. Great neighbours are a big part of that but also the larger Barrhaven community as a whole. Darrell has been very active in Barrhaven with the West Barrhaven Community Association and the Canada Day celebrations, which bring thousands of us together every year, but it was last year that he truly saw our community spirit come out in full force after the devastating tornadoes that ripped through the neighbouring communities of Arlington Woods and Craig Henry, and also left much of Barrhaven without power for a couple of days. Darrell, along with the West 

Barrhaven Community Association, was involved and instrumental in providing food at Larkin
Park for our community and the neighbouring communities as well.. With the help of Jan Harder and Lisa MacLeod, calls through social media were made for donations and volunteers and the response was overwhelming. It showed the true character and spirit that is Barrhaven.

Darrell also urges Barrhaven residents to get involved with our community. We have 4 active community associations and numerous volunteer opportunities throughout the year. It’s the people that make all these things possible and these events truly bring our community together.

Darrell Bartraw’s Barrhaven Favourites

Favourite Bar and Patio: He has three and it’s hard to choose! 

  • Broadway Bar & Grill – Fun fact: Darrell was their first customer! If you stop by Broadway’s, Darrel loves their Jambalaya but make sure to ask them to make it with penne pasta instead of rice.
  • The Royal Oak – The Royal Oak is great for wings and appetizers! Make sure to try the antojitos!
  • Heart and Crown – If you stop by the Heart and Crown, you can’t go wrong if your order “Shannon’s Salad”

 

Favourite Butcher: Darrell loves to stop by Pete & Gus’ to pick up a California roast. He recommends buying the biggest one they have, for the left overs. Bring it home, cover it in a mixture of soy sauce, worchestershire sauce, and garlic and pop it in the oven for 50-60 minutes.

Best Pizza: “San Man’s” – Darrell loves San Marino Pizza but doesn’t have a standard order as it depends on who he will be sharing it with. Meat, peppers, and mushrooms do make him happy though!

Favourite Coffee Shop: Darrell is adamant about supporting local and loves to grab a coffee at either Anabia’s Cupcakery Cafe or Cafe Cristal.

Best Greek Food: Pinelopi’s, hands down (just don’t ask him how it’s pronounced…) His favourite dish is the Santorini Chicken.

Best Italian Food: If you haven’t had a chance, check out La Porto a Casa but make sure to make a reservation well in advance as they are always booked solid.

Favourite Place for a Night Out: Greenfields features live music most weekends with a lot of tribute bands!

Favourite Grocery Stores: Darrell likes to frequent the two grocery stores that are strongly committed to the community: Sobey’s and Ross’ Your Indepedent Grocer.
